An exciting media agency in London is looking for a
GCP Data Engineer to support a leading client, helping to build a new marketing data capability within Snowflake and enable reporting, analytics and measurement.
- Based in London - fully in the office
- 3 days per week throughout August, increasing to 4 days per week in September
- 2 months initially
- Start date: ASAP
- £365pd Outside IR35
- The Job
- As the
GCP Data Engineer , your responsibilities will include
- Leading the integration of media and marketing data into Snowflake.
- Designing and supporting scalable data pipelines and data models.
- Working closely with agency and client stakeholders to define requirements.
- Enabling reporting, analytics and marketing measurement capabilities.
- Ensuring data governance, quality and documentation standards are maintained.
- You
- Strong experience with Snowflake, GCP, Looker, and Salesforce
- Data integration and data modelling expertise
- Experience working with marketing, media or customer data
- Strong stakeholder management skills
- Agency, consultancy or client-facing experience preferred
